Title:
METHOD AND DEVICE FOR CODING VOICE
Document Type and Number:
Japanese Patent JP3453116
Kind Code:
B2
Abstract:

PROBLEM TO BE SOLVED: To code a voice pitch which is a voice coding parameter of analytico- synthetic type, vocal/silent information and amplitude of harmonics spectrum with a small number of bits.
SOLUTION: The voice pitch is quantized by switching a frame of logarithmic pitch, which is quantized by uniform/differential selection, to a frame, which is quantized by an interpolating pitch candidate index between the frames, by an input switching part 103. The vocal/silent information is quantized by switching a frame, which is quantized by an index of the vocal/silent information selected from representative vocal/silent information 132, to a frame, which does not transmit the vocal/silent information, by a frame thinning part 133. The amplitude of harmonics spectrum is quantized by switching a frame, which is modeled by an autoregressive linear predictive model adjusted in spectrum, to a frame which is quantized by the index of interpolating candidate of modeling coefficient, by an input switching part 141. As a result, the voice coding parameter can be satisfactorily quantized with low bit rate.
